Single dose partial breast irradiation using an MRI linear accelerator in the supine and prone treatment position
BACKGROUND: In selected patients with early-stage and low-risk breast cancer, an MRI-linac based treatment might enable a radiosurgical, non-invasive alternative for current standard breast conserving therapy.
